What Is Shopify?

Shopify is a cloud-based eCommerce platform that helps you set up an online store and sell products. It operates on a subscription model, meaning you pay a monthly fee to use its features. With Shopify, you don’t need advanced technical skills or coding knowledge—it provides ready-to-use templates and tools to help you build and run your store.

Whether you sell physical goods, digital products, or services, Shopify offers the flexibility to handle various business models.


Key Features of Shopify

  1. Easy Store Setup
    Shopify’s drag-and-drop builder and pre-designed templates make it easy to create a professional-looking store in minutes.

  2. Wide Range of Themes
    Choose from free and premium themes that are mobile-responsive and customizable to match your brand.

  3. Payment Integration

    • Accept payments via Shopify Payments, PayPal, Stripe, and more.
    • Support for over 100 payment gateways worldwide.
  4. Inventory Management

    • Track stock levels in real-time.
    • Manage products with variants like size, color, and material.
  5. Mobile-Friendly
    Shopify ensures your store looks great and performs well on mobile devices, which is essential for modern online shopping.

  6. Built-In Marketing Tools

    • SEO optimization features like customizable URLs, meta descriptions, and sitemaps.
    • Email marketing and social media integration to promote your products.
  7. App Store
    Shopify’s App Store offers thousands of apps to enhance your store’s functionality, including tools for shipping, analytics, and customer engagement.

  8. Multichannel Selling

    • Sell directly on Facebook, Instagram, Amazon, eBay, and other platforms.
    • Integrate your online store with in-person sales via Shopify POS (Point of Sale).
  9. Secure and Reliable

    • Built-in SSL certificates ensure secure transactions.
    • 24/7 uptime and reliable hosting for uninterrupted service.
  10. Comprehensive Analytics
    Get insights into your sales, customer behavior, and store performance through detailed reports.

Shopify Pricing Plans

Shopify offers several pricing tiers to suit different business needs:

  1. Shopify Starter ($5/month): Ideal for selling on social media and messaging apps.
  2. Basic Shopify ($39/month): Includes an online store and basic features.
  3. Shopify Plan ($105/month): Suitable for growing businesses, with more tools and analytics.
  4. Advanced Shopify ($399/month): Advanced reporting and features for scaling businesses.
  5. Shopify Plus: Enterprise-level solution with custom pricing for large businesses.

Each plan includes a free 3-day trial, so you can explore Shopify’s features before committing.

How to Get Started with Shopify

  1. Sign Up for a Free Trial
    Visit Shopify.com and start your free trial.

  2. Choose a Theme
    Select a theme that aligns with your brand, then customize it using Shopify’s editor.

  3. Add Products
    Upload your product details, images, and pricing. Organize them into collections if needed.

  4. Set Up Payment and Shipping Options
    Configure payment gateways and shipping rates to suit your business.

  5. Launch Your Store
    Once everything is ready, hit "Publish" to make your store live.
